several versions of synthetic material boot knives were available some years ago from the combat/secret ops catalogs. Fiberglass on one and glass-loaded nylon on another, IIRC. micarta has been used, too. They wouldn't hold an edge, but were meant for one-stick use, so to speak. I don't know if they're still available.
